Abstract

This study aimed to analyze the implementation of the Insurance and Actuarial Olympiad in Timor-Leste as a non-formal educational initiative to enhance risk literacy and support sustainable development. It employed a descriptive case study design with a non-experimental quantitative approach and secondary data analysis. The data comprised all 105 registration records from the 2025 Timor-Leste Insurance and Actuarial Olympiad. Descriptive analysis was conducted based on participants’ school origins, geographical distribution, and selected competition fields. The results showed that 96 registrants (91.4%) were from Timor-Leste, while nine (8.6%) were from Indonesia. Most registrants were concentrated in Baucau, with 48 participants (45.7%), and Dili, with 27 participants (25.7%). The Insurance category was selected by 62 participants (59.0%), whereas 43 participants (41.0%) selected the Actuarial category. These findings indicate the program’s geographical reach and participants’ initial interest but do not demonstrate an improvement in risk literacy. The Olympiad could be developed into a continuous learning program through preparatory materials, case-based questions, feedback, and pre- and post-event evaluations using validated bilingual instruments.
